Real estate agent costs, simply as their name would lead you to believe, are the expense of working with a Real estate agent. That said, these expenses can appear challenging and at times downright confusing, which begs the concern: What are Realtor Charges? Real estate agent costs are not an upfront cost, but rather a portion of the resulting list prices.

That stated, it's rather common for the seller to select up the tab. For the a lot of part, Realtor costs are normally paid by the seller at the closing table, as the charge is usually subtracted from the earnings of the impending sale. More particularly, the seller generally pays the listing broker who, in turn, shares the revenues with the subsequent Realtor the one who presented the purchaser.

Some sellers might work out for the purchaser to pay the charges at closing, however, once again, that's the exception. Feel in one's bones this: sellers will generally pay the fees. Although, you may find some buyers provide to pay the charges to make their deal look more attractive in the middle of a bidding war. Once again, anything is possible.

It is rather typical, nevertheless, for the buyer's agent and the seller's representative to receive about half of the commission each. If the same agent is representing both sides of a deal, there's an opportunity they will lower their commission. Every detail about a property representative's commission with any transaction charges must be described in the agreement that you sign when you work with an agent.

It defines how long the representative will represent you typically between 90 to 120 days. Usually, genuine estate representatives and Realtors will charge somewhere in between five and 6 percent of the list prices. Having said that, there is no universal amount for just how much a representative will make on a house sale. It is, however, possible to determine just how much a Real estate agent fee equates to in the typical home sale.

So if you wish to understand how much the average Real estate agent makes in costs on the typical home list prices, just take six percent of $230,000, which is $13,800. That implies the average Real estate agent charge is someplace around $13,800. But remember, the cost is usually divided in 2, to pay the representatives representing each side of the offer.

Nevertheless, this Realtor cost amount only equates to the commission they will make from a given offer. There are still costs that can be sustained while the home is on the marketplace. Depending on whether you are buying or offering, these can be crucial to try to find. A few examples of Realtor fees, aside from commission, are as follows: Home Evaluation: Real estate agents will typically ask for a house evaluation and appraisal while the residential or commercial property is still on the market.

Home assessment costs vary however can vary anywhere from $200 to $400 depending on the marketplace. Photography: While not all sellers select professional stagings, they ought to at the extremely least safe professional photographs for the listing. Many knowledgeable Real estate agents will currently have an expert connection when they handle a listing, and costs can vary appropriately.

Staging: Staging is among the best ways to hook potential purchasers, but it does come at a price. Realtors will usually work with expert stagers, which can vary anywhere from $400 to $500 a space each month. Again, these costs differ depending on the market and property size. Closing Costs: Technically speaking, closing costs are not consisted of as part of Real estate agent fees.

Closing expenses cover loan fees, title business fees, insurance, taxes, property surveyor expenses, recording of the real estate deed, and more. Closing costs will differ with each distinct house sale or purchase and can range from 2% to 7% of the purchase cost.
